Chile and United States
Chile scores 55/100 toward United States (neutrality or uncertainty), while United States scores 45/100 back.
Chile toward United States
Chile’s posture is characterized by active resistance to US diplomatic pressure regarding trade with China, specifically pushing back against Washington's efforts to curb Beijing's influence, which signals a defensive and assertive stance rather than passive alignment.
United States toward Chile
The US posture is defined by strategic pressure to limit Chile’s economic ties with China, indicating a competitive and demanding relationship, albeit one that still includes routine operational cooperation like gang extraditions.
